
In Chennai’s elite Venus Colony is a 7,000 sq. ft. architectural gem, as soon as a colonial-style bungalow, now reborn as the private {and professional} sanctuary of actor Nayanthara and her husband, filmmaker Vignesh Shivan. Their uniquely designed home-studio is a celebration of South Indian craftsmanship, outside dwelling, and trendy luxe aesthetics.
The transformation of the property was spearheaded by Nikhita Reddy, founding father of The Storey Collective, who turned the classic house into a classy, useful, and sun-drenched studio-retreat in simply 40 days. Chatting with Architectural Digest India, Reddy defined, “I’d name it a remodelling undertaking, with the addition of some newly constructed areas, just like the terraces.” She fastidiously retained the bungalow’s authentic exterior construction whereas opening up the interiors, enhancing air flow, and enhancing the pure mild.
The aesthetic is a sublime interaction of earthy tones, teak wooden, woven fibres, linen, and rattan, which preserve the environment grounded and textured. “I needed to retain the essence of the bungalow whereas enhancing it to make it brighter by bringing in a lot of pure mild,” Nayanthara mentioned.
This can be a complete home-studio geared up with all the things from a convention room to devoted workspaces for his or her inventive groups. There’s a comfortable lounge for intimate gatherings, visitor bedrooms for his or her crew, and a landscaped outside yard eating space excellent for al fresco meals.
A spotlight is the pair of double-height glass homes, ultra-modern constructions that bookend a central terrace, offering a recent distinction to the country components of the unique structure. “My most favorite half is Vignesh’s studio together with the terrace café lounge the place we host visitors frequently,” Nayanthara added.
All through, the interiors pay homage to conventional South-Indian structure via using native supplies, genuine picket pillars, and delicate pottery and artefacts, all fastidiously chosen or custom-made.
It’s, in each sense, a spot the place creativity can thrive and private moments can unfold in privateness. Designed not only for aesthetic pleasure but in addition for performance, the couple’s Chennai bungalow is an area the place heritage meets excessive design.
